    You can Paint, Stain, Stencil, Paper, or Upholster them. You can add trim or carvings to them such as the wood shapes at a hardware store or iron trivets. You could use a wood burning pen and do some pyrography on them. You could even hang a fringe or lace from them. The sky is the limit!!

    Hope these ideas help spark the perfect plan for you valances!!
